7-. Maintenance and cleaning
General warning: Cleaning and
maintenance should be done when the
appliance is cold and disconnected from
the mains. Do not immerse the appliance
in water. It should not be cleaned in a
dishwasher.
1-. Cleaning the outside: To clean the
outside of the machine, use alcohol 96º
or specific products for polished
aluminium. if you have a colour dream,
for the painted parts, you can use a soft
cloth, moistened with water.
Remove the tray regularly and clean it.
If the machine is not to be used for some
time, empty the water reservoir.
Clean the steam tube with a damp cloth
immediately after use. To cleanthe inside
of the steam tube, allow the water to
circulate. To clean the absorption hole,
you can use a toothpick or a paperclip.
This will ensure the tube is free of
blockages.
2-. Internal cleaning: To obtain top
quality espresso coffee it is vital to clean
the inner workings of the machine. To
clean the interior of the distribution unit,
use Ascaso Coffee Washer. This product
is also useful to prevent limescale
buildup in the machine. Regular
descaling will contribute to ensuring top
quality coffee and it will prolong the
useful life of the machine.
Consult your distributor.
Coffee Washer use recommendations:
To avoid limescale buildup, you can also
use water treatment filters. However, it
is advisable to clean the machine in
accordance with consumption. Using
filters and Coffee Washer will help to
maintain the coffee machine in optimum
working condition for longer.
Important
It is advisable not to leave the pod
or ground coffee in the filterholder.
Otherwise, coffee will build up
affecting the taste of the coffee.
Should this occur, run a load of water
through the system.
3-. Cleaning the filterholders and the
showerheads
Mobile filterholder: Wash the filterholder
in hot water with a neutral detergent.
Rinse thoroughly. Dry the filterholder
with a soft cloth. Do not wash it in the
dishwasher.
The filters, tray and reservoir can be
cleaned in the top of the dishwasher. If
you wash them by hand, do not forget
to rinse thoroughly. Dry with a soft cloth.
Use a brush or similar item to remove
coffee residue from the showerhead.
Important
(Mobile filterholder)
The showerhead must be
cleaned after 80 to 100
espresso coffees have
been made. This should
done as follows:
Remove and clean the
showerhead with hot water
with a neutral detergent.
Once clean, replace it,
following the instructions
for the previous operation
in reverse.
